Telehealth is rapidly transforming healthcare, and its impact on hypertension management is significant. Telehealth allows patients to monitor their blood pressure at home, share readings with their healthcare providers, and receive medication adjustments remotely. This can lead to better blood pressure control and reduced hospital readmissions. When evaluating hospitals, patients should inquire about their telehealth capabilities and the availability of remote monitoring programs.

**Specialty Centers and Cardiac Rehabilitation**
Specialty centers specializing in cardiology are also important. These centers often have expertise in managing complex cases of hypertension. They may offer advanced diagnostic testing and specialized treatments. Patients should research the affiliations of these centers with hospitals in the area. Cardiac rehabilitation programs are also critical. These programs help patients recover from cardiac events and manage their blood pressure through exercise, education, and lifestyle modifications.
